The Early Days
Genghis Khan, originally named Temujin, was born into the Borjigin tribe of the Mongol people. Growing up in the harsh and unforgiving terrain of the Mongolian steppes, he learned the way of the warrior from an early age. With a strong desire for unity among the warring tribes, Temujin embarked on a mission to establish a vast empire that would stretch across Asia, Europe, and the Middle East.
Through a combination of strategic alliances, military prowess, and innovative tactics, Genghis Khan succeeded in unifying the various Mongolian tribes. He instituted a meritocracy, rewarding loyalty and skill, regardless of social status. This approach proved instrumental in his conquests and the rapid rise of the Mongol Empire.

The Conquest of Empires
Genghis Khan's military campaigns were characterized by their speed, brutality, and unrelenting determination. He employed a formidable cavalry force and developed revolutionary tactics, such as the feigned retreat and the effective use of archers on horseback. These strategies allowed his armies to defeat much larger and more established opponents.
Under Genghis Khan's leadership, the Mongols decimated the Khwarazmian Empire, a powerful force that spanned parts of Central Asia and the Middle East. The conquest of Khwarazm provided the Mongols with vast resources, including skilled artisans, scholars, and a vast wealth of knowledge that greatly influenced their subsequent rule.
Genghis Khan's empire expanded rapidly, engulfing other formidable empires like the Jin Dynasty in northern China, the Kara-Khitan Khanate in Central Asia, and the Kipchak Khanate in Eastern Europe. His relentless pursuit of conquest led to the creation of an empire that stretched from the Pacific Ocean to the Caspian Sea.
The Mysterious Death of a Legend
Despite his many victories, Genghis Khan's life came to an equally enigmatic end. The details surrounding his death remain shrouded in mystery. According to historical accounts, he died in 1227 while on a military campaign against the Tangut Empire. However, the precise cause of his demise is a subject of debate and speculation.
Some theories propose that Genghis Khan died due to an injury sustained during battle, while others suggest he succumbed to an infectious disease. There are even legends that claim he was assassinated. The truth may never be known, as the Mongols strictly guarded the location of his burial site, adding to the mystique surrounding his death.

Genghis Khan is one of history's immortals, alive in memory as a scourge, hero, military genius and demi-god. To Muslims, Russians and westerners, he is a murderer of millions, a brutal oppressor. Yet in his homeland of Mongolia he is the revered father of the nation, and the Chinese honor him as the founder of a dynasty. In his so-called Mausoleum in Inner Mongolia, worshippers seek the blessing of his spirit. In a supreme paradox, the world's most ruthless conqueror has become a force for peace and reconciliation.
As a teenager, Genghis was a fugitive, hiding from enemies on a remote mountainside. Yet he went on to found the world's greatest land empire and change the course of world history. Brilliant and original as well as ruthless, he ruled an empire twice the size of Rome's until his death in 1227 placed all at risk. To secure his conquests and then extend them, his heirs kept his death a secret, and secrecy has surrounded him ever since. His undiscovered grave, with its imagined treasures, remains the subject of intrigue and speculation.
